From d7102973717128fffae41d9e04c1fa7b648ad864 Mon Sep 17 00:00:00 2001 From: mhenke Date: Wed, 13 Jan 2010 19:01:46 -0500 Subject: [PATCH] updating code for wheels 1.0 --- cachebox.cfc | 31 +++---------------------------- releases/CacheBox-0.1.zip | Bin 2159 -> 1855 bytes 2 files changed, 3 insertions(+), 28 deletions(-) diff --git a/cachebox.cfc b/cachebox.cfc index 3689c9b..d0e7be1 100644 --- a/cachebox.cfc +++ b/cachebox.cfc @@ -1,34 +1,9 @@ - + - - - - - - var loc = {}; - if (application.wheels.environment != "production") - { - if (ListLen(arguments.reserved)) - { - loc.iEnd = ListLen(arguments.reserved); - for (loc.i=1; loc.i <= loc.iEnd; loc.i++) - { - loc.item = ListGetAt(arguments.reserved, loc.i); - if (StructKeyExists(arguments.input, loc.item)) - $throw(type="Wheels.IncorrectArguments", message="The '#loc.item#' argument is not allowed.", extendedInfo="Do not pass in the '#loc.item#' argument. It will be set automatically by Wheels."); - } - } - } - StructAppend(arguments.input, application.wheels.functions[arguments.name], false); - loc.returnValue = arguments.input; - - - - @@ -69,13 +44,13 @@ var loc = {}; if (Len(arguments.category)) { - loc.returnValue = application.wheels.cache[arguments.category].getHeadCount(); + loc.returnValue = application.wheels.cache[arguments.category].getSize(); } else { loc.returnValue = 0; for (loc.key in application.wheels.cache) { - loc.returnValue = loc.returnValue + application.wheels.cache[loc.key].getHeadCount(); + loc.returnValue = loc.returnValue + application.wheels.cache[loc.key].getSize(); } } diff --git a/releases/CacheBox-0.1.zip b/releases/CacheBox-0.1.zip index 5a6342ef92cbc9ca74165f4f2495c96ef09bb12a..a907458c6aaa21ef2c7a4f264ce3a7a624203dfd 100644 GIT binary patch delta 804 zcmV+<1Ka%X5Wfz8P)h>@6aWAK2mo-AEj)>68P>Z3001%y000aC002W_V`ybUZ+I?a zW@F7(O>f&U3_Yj6LU0Du!2%~erx`F5*k!%7*rn(}m1#$-EqM~1E(`MCM@e?vd@k9# zVYf&WA0PRi>naQK&~D3&?OLZ88UA-H|Da zu99&wZVwp1+9-d9cCJSq8Z9q&!Qb&Tz1KHf%phVR85b1==31r^<3fP7)2OPS3MnF{ zYpiOVMj0_VUN+Vn2k$@a)J77x}?u|z51z4tQm9kKe z(=UmamRXcV!AM7$`lGvaJKZ~Yp%oG(s!q^U-9vE#Gqpgb4bx9wLEzApO|`m2_QGk> zs9DK>pMi-PS2#u>DfG6d5&fF@6vj?ik$QLkRIEvl!u%|NN=;0*U4yla2vIKcBP z1K%qG^`2p)Q)cC%Zpbs(j%njD{jEuz-}0|7m^1$^sCc*O!NA3rdwhNNg`;QcPX2&+ zFljv5qw{bKemwDkj4p$}I5c=B)xoOas_sQ@+TMA8n0hF*!Pld%-u^0y0=Rk0TXeoR z`r*C#42xT7F+Moj{&5pE>-Mu*5Z1l^XbfM(Ehiddb4sqIy=cUBJ69756iAPlOY?5b z!~5u>k|euo1wN>q&v=lJ>#G`yu8w?C!>ap}_!Ce|0|b-s2O6_81c?I@6aWAK2mpy$UpugVr8DaT001Qp000aC002W_V`ybUZ+I?a zW@F7)UvJYe5Pxnz#gQVd6;)OwUQh|r#DBpX6Fi_jc+RCYBzCZ!cGcAH&e@5Rb!$sI z24YgH+UNV-zu%p`7d+#tD3wHMU-o-I>#UO83ME0Z0+UF8NMR!q^+;sUf}IN!FHjqI zB!OrWKaZb<0~&3mr9VSEFHSo&TGGZH^v6OP)b=%Itjev4phmE(l7zx?Qof%RRsmn;JWV!S{NZ`4*F*$G^R;JxVQD%XbIUVcJ>cb z)JSnGFx_Q;GhSDC98WBrv7ZEGz`5$ z@^lLR2fRoiKr~xVo)CPE-x{!3GzQ+GJ+oU(jB90oZ>b63vrqp=T)nv>MRP;RSBW$l zXcv$Fdu-=gEr)dlzSimbAi2^SxjhT&(HIKi6PwYY^EtxFAOH1nv6! zmg>v?W~cYJ^f^n@bM=bxId1m&LW%TV9sUDX_i6Bjb2un6xjIbCif)`p5@^Bqwf103 zO&Xz3!8ySVwp$`4oGHCJe2x@M$o;bfnrfSWlDU!nN+TI@K76K);bc4+ca?XMjwhp5 zhs~UC$u^d87s?HW1=lY&m1AR-#v8n)%8k>ihP%1%OEVe=PrVNv0S_VB4DDO3iVd2z zmHwA3`{*W!WOYf7tX7<%W66Q*-$4G%feG!|-sj&T3MT>CS|p*@Z=cvTXp z=M0=4k}D7Oia29Knl^^%y)t!t$iHuYFh~B)H&C!L8aes(7G59Sa5SdgBTIcchW;*I zJ6KY}eKscE!|oME*{7GsPSbV2ZbiDi^JKUGwV}ICd+7DUHx4)s6<5@B=;o<2X ztizr89sKqM@7Cc0%?ayVooUTh!{8I8u{kB$`u3X&yPc;~66BV~nN#z;oYj*d(n$r? z?P;j;&H{RkZ{nhD+S=%P&*fULy8jD*0Z>Z=1e3r98nXifi31LaSzkM_ex)<(0{{Re d4wIS&N&*!Glja6B0<{E_9S0l+um=DD004)S3wZzl